AutoCAD Electrical 2018 is a specialized CAD application designed specifically for electrical engineers. Unlike vanilla AutoCAD, which treats everything as generic lines and blocks, Electrical 2018 understands the intelligence behind the drawing.

It automates tedious tasks such as numbering wires, generating Bill of Materials (BOMs), and creating terminal strip drawings. The 2018 iteration brought significant performance enhancements over 2017, particularly in the "Project Manager" interface and real-time error checking.

Comprehensive Guide to Autodesk AutoCAD Electrical 2018 (32-Bit & 64-Bit)

Autodesk AutoCAD Electrical 2018 remains a cornerstone for electrical engineers and designers who require a specialized toolset for creating, modifying, and documenting electrical controls systems. While newer versions exist, the 2018 release is often sought after for its stability and its ability to run on a wide range of hardware configurations, including both 32-bit and 64-bit systems.

In this guide, we will explore the core features, system requirements, and the distinct advantages of using the Electrical toolset over standard AutoCAD. What is AutoCAD Electrical 2018?

AutoCAD Electrical is a "vertical" version of the standard AutoCAD software. It includes all the functionality of AutoCAD plus a complete set of features developed specifically for electrical design. It automates common tasks such as numbering wires and generating bills of materials, which significantly reduces the margin for error. Key Features of the 2018 Version

The 2018 release introduced several refinements to improve the user experience and drafting speed:

Comprehensive Symbol Libraries: Access to over 65,000 intelligent electrical symbols that support various standards (AS, GB, IEC, JIC, JIS, NFPA, and IEEE).

Automatic Wire Numbering and Tagging: Automatically assign unique wire numbers and component tags to reduce manual entry time.

Real-Time Error Checking: The software identifies potential problems—such as duplicate wire numbers or missing components—as you design, rather than after the project is finished. How it works:

Project Management: Manage thousands of drawings within a single project interface, allowing for cross-referencing and global updates across the entire set.

Circuit Builder: A dynamic tool that helps you create motor control circuits or power distribution circuits based on wire material and load requirements. 32-Bit vs. 64-Bit Compatibility

One of the unique aspects of AutoCAD Electrical 2018 is that it was among the last versions to offer robust support for 32-bit architectures.

64-Bit Version: Highly recommended for modern workstations. It allows the software to access more system memory (RAM), which is crucial when working on large, complex multi-sheet electrical projects.

32-Bit Version: Ideal for legacy systems or specialized industrial computers that have not yet transitioned to 64-bit operating systems. Note that 32-bit systems are limited to 4GB of RAM, which can affect performance on very large projects. System Requirements

To ensure a smooth workflow, your hardware should meet these minimum specifications for the 2018 release: Requirement Operating System Microsoft Windows 7 SP1, 8.1, or 10 (32-bit or 64-bit) Processor 1 GHz or faster (32-bit or 64-bit) Memory (RAM) 2 GB (32-bit); 4 GB (64-bit) Disk Space 12.0 GB for installation Display 1360 x 768 (1920 x 1080 recommended) Why Choose AutoCAD Electrical 2018?

Even years after its release, professionals use this version because of its File Compatibility. The 2018 DWG format is widely recognized, ensuring that files can be shared with clients and contractors using both older and newer versions of AutoCAD. Additionally, the interface is familiar to long-time users, requiring a shorter learning curve compared to the more drastically redesigned recent versions.

Autodesk AutoCAD Electrical 2018 is a specialized toolset for electrical design, offering high-level automation for schematic and panel layouts. While it is a robust version, it has largely been superseded by newer subscription-based models. 💻 System Requirements

The 2018 version supports both 32-bit and 64-bit architectures, though Windows 10 users are limited to the 64-bit version. 32-bit Requirement 64-bit Requirement Windows 7 SP1, 8.1 Windows 7 SP1, 8.1, 10 1 GHz or faster (x86) 1 GHz or faster (x64) 2 GB (4 GB recommended) 4 GB (8 GB recommended) Disk Space 12 GB for installation 12 GB for installation 1360 x 768 (True Color) 1360 x 768 (Up to 4K on Win10) DirectX 9 minimum; DirectX 11 recommended for optimal performance.

Internet Explorer 11 or later is required for certain connected features. ⚡ Key Features & Improvements

The 2018 release introduced several quality-of-life updates specifically for electrical engineers: 4K Monitor Support:

Optimized over 200 dialog boxes and interface elements for high-resolution displays. SQL Server Support:

Enhanced the SQL Content Migration Utility to move user-defined tables from MDB to SQL Server, including improved support for international characters. Symbol Libraries: Updated symbols (e.g., NFPA library) to comply with the NFPA 79 2015 edition standards. PDF Enhancements: Introduced SHX Text Recognition to convert geometry from imported PDFs into editable text. File Performance: Updated the DWG format

to increase the efficiency of opening and saving files with many annotative objects. Autodesk Community, Autodesk Forums, Autodesk Forum ⚠️ Current Support Status
